The unique microclimate of these high end areas typically renders typical building choices insufficient. Basic concrete or clay roofing tiles tend to develop great cracks during serious storms or can be displaced by strong winds, immediately permitting moisture to infiltrate. Contemporary metal systems deal with these concerns by offering impressive tensile strength and seamless interlocking styles that develop a unified barrier for your home. Regional professionals have an extensive grasp of how salty sea air impacts different materials, regularly recommending using premium alloys and marine‑grade coatings particularly engineered to curb early oxidation and rust.

Energy performance is another engaging factor driving the extensive adoption of metal systems throughout the region. Summertimes in New South Wales typically bring severe heatwaves that radiate through structure envelopes, causing indoor temperature levels to skyrocket and forcing environment control systems to run continuously. High quality metal setups include advanced thermal efficiency, showing a vast bulk of solar radiation away from the structure instead of soaking up and transferring it into the living spaces. When incorporated with premium acoustic blankets and tailored ventilation systems, the internal climate ends up being significantly more steady, leading to lower power usage and decreased electrical energy bills throughout the peak summertime.

Accurate execution during the capping, flashing, and valley integration stages is important to eliminate capillary action, avoiding water from being drawn upward into tight structural spaces. Custom-made guttering profiles and high capacity downpipes complete the structure, guaranteeing that even during extreme tropical downpours, stormwater is rapidly carried away from the main structures.
Ecological sustainability is also a major factor to consider for modern-day home renovators throughout Australia. Steel is an entirely circular resource, suggesting it can be recycled indefinitely without experiencing any loss in its structural stability or quality, which dramatically minimizes the volume of construction waste heading to regional land fill sites. In addition, the non poisonous, tidy surface area of contemporary covered steel provides a best catchment zone for beautiful rainwater harvesting, allowing families to keep landscaping while decreasing their dependence on the main local water supply.
